TSA Officers Spot Something Suspicious in a Flip-Flop—Turns Out, It’s Totally Banned

TSA officials had found yet another prohibited item inside a carry-on luggage. The individual who attempted to hide the item put quite a bit of thought into concealing it inside the sole of a flip-flop.

According to reports, the discovery was made at Washington Dulles International Airport on March 30. The agents at the airport were able to stop the traveler from catching his flight with this prohibited item.

A TSA spokesperson for the Northeast division revealed that a utility blade had been hidden within the sole of a flip-flop, right underneath the cushion bed. The official X (formerly Twitter) also shared a photo of it, sparking some interesting reactions from the followers.

Lisa Farbstein, a TSA spokesperson, wrote, “A good example of why TSA requires travelers to remove their footwear to be screened via X-ray.” She further confirmed that the flyer who committed the offense was denied entry through security. However, in such cases, the traveler would be generally allowed to catch his flight, but the item would be confiscated.

It is important to note that the agency can definitely impose civil penalties on passengers. Their website strictly mentions all the prohibited items that could result in a hefty fine if attempted to be carried inside the airport. For example, carrying a knife could lead to a fine of up to $2,570, especially if the individual is a repeat offender. If you are carrying other prohibited items such as explosives or loaded guns, you could risk a penalty as high as $17,000. There could also be a criminal referral in such cases.

You can check the details about all prohibited items along with the penalties for them on the Transportation Security Administration‘s official website. The agency also has a list for sharp objects that could be carried inside the check-in baggage but not carry-on. For examples, things like box cutters, cockscrews with blade, darts, kirpans, ice picks, knives, e.t.c. could be carried only inside your check-in baggage.

These discoveries were made just months after the Abolish TSA Act was introduced by Republican Senators Mike Lee of Utah and Timmy Tuberville of Alabama. This act intends to dismantle the agency and favor privatized security at facilities where the TSA currently operates.

After the bill was introduced, Rep. Jared Moskowitz mocked the Abolish the TSA Act, saying that “Bin Laden” would approve it.
